Adams County Housing Nonprofits Face Major Funding Cuts

Adams County Housing Nonprofits Face Major Funding Cuts In a troubling shift for housing stability, Adams County has drastically reduced its rental assistance funding for 2025. These cuts stem from a 2022 state law and depleted reserve funds that pushed more direct cash aid to residents—leaving fewer resources for long-standing support programs. As a result, contracts through the Temporary Assistance for Needy Families (TANF) program have been shortened and downsized, slashing the county’s $4.5 million discretionary pool.
